Budgeting for Your Shower Remodel



How do you determine a budget for your shower renovate? Start by analyzing your economic scenario and make a decision how much you can comfortably spend.

Break down expenses into categories like materials, labor, and unanticipated expenses. Study the typical costs for the kind of shower you want; this'll offer you a reasonable baseline.

Do not neglect to consider prospective upgrades, like better fixtures or extra storage. It's wise to set aside a minimum of 10-15% of your budget for shocks that could appear throughout the remodel.

Pipes and Room Demands



Prior to diving right into your shower remodel, it's vital to evaluate your pipes and room demands to ensure a seamless setup.

Begin by inspecting the existing pipes setup. You'll need to know where the water system lines and drainpipe lie and whether they can support your new shower design. If you're considering moving fixtures, you could need professional assistance to stay clear of pricey errors.
